Rawalpindi, colloquially known as Pindi, is the third-largest city in the Pakistani province of Punjab, serving as the principal commercial and industrial hub of northern Punjab. It is the fourth-most populous city in Pakistan and ranks as the world's third-largest Punjabi-speaking metropolis. Located along the Soan River in north-western Punjab, Rawalpindi lies adjacent to Pakistan's capital, Islamabad, and the two are jointly known as the "twin cities".
